Built in the 12th-13th centuries, the church was originally the castle chapel. Richard C?ur de Lion's entrails are said to be buried here. The porch of the gateway to the castle courtyard, the triumphal arch separating the nave from the choir, and a niche with an accolade in the chapel all remain. A capital from the Romanesque choir is still in situ. Fragments of columns, capitals and statue supports are housed in the château.
